Work profile of Network Engineers?

A network engineer is a professional, who handles both hardware and software facets in networking. The work profile of a network engineer is vast and includes implementation & complete maintenance of PC configuration, system architecture, wired & wireless networking, troubleshooting, managing proper functioning of system software and so.

CCNA Certification

Cisco provides certification for different level work profiles, including CCNA, CCNP, CCIE and CCSP. Out of all these, CCNA (Cisco Certified Network Professional) is the entry level & most sought after certification program. Through CCNA course training, the learners develop their skills in varied specializations like system switching & routing, security, voice and wireless system, & service provider operations. CCNA certified professionals work in small to mid-sized and large enterprises, handling most of the system networking and infrastructure, inclusive of like installation, configuration and maintenance of networks (LAN, VPN, WAN), diagnosing and troubleshooting problems, network log monitoring, system upgrades and security testing, and much more.

As IT system is an essential architecture for small to large organizations across all spectrums and industries, network engineers are one of their most important assets, handling system architecture and infrastructure. The career options for CCNA professionals are wide, from system and network maintenance, to system security (ethical hacking), network trainers and more in varied enterprises nationally as well as internationally.
